What Is A Tesla Powerwall 3?

The Tesla Powerwall 3 is a rechargeable lithium-ion battery designed to store energy for home use. It can be paired with solar panels to store excess energy generated during the day, which can then be used during the night or during power outages. This not only maximises the use of renewable energy but also provides homeowners with energy independence and security.

How Much Does a Tesla Powerwall 3 Cost?

The Tesla Powerwall 3, the latest model of 2024, is priced starting from £8,495.

Factors Influencing the Total Cost

Several factors can affect the total cost of your Tesla Powerwall 3 installation.

  • System Size: The size and capacity of your solar panel system, and whether you need additional Powerwalls, will impact the overall cost.
  • Installation Complexity: The complexity of the installation, including the location of your electrical panel and the need for any upgrades or modifications, can affect labour costs.
  • Permitting and Inspection Fees: Local permitting and inspection fees can add to the total cost.
  • Additional Components: Additional components such as inverters, monitoring systems, and mounting hardware may also contribute to the total expense.

Benefits of Installing a Tesla Powerwall 3

  • Energy Independence: Store excess solar energy and use it when you need it, reducing reliance on the grid.
  • Backup Power: Ensure your home has power during outages, providing peace of mind and security.
  • Cost Savings: Reduce energy bills by using stored energy during peak times when electricity rates are higher.
  • Environmental Impact: Maximise the use of renewable energy and reduce your carbon footprint.
